How much do remote full stack web developer j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 16, 2026, the average yearly pay for remote full stack web developer in Illinois is $114,229.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$77,500.00 and $124,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Remote Full Stack Web Developer position,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Full Stack Web Developer, you need strong proficiency in both front-end and back-end technologies, such as JavaScript frameworks, HTML, CSS, SQL/NoSQL databases, and version control systems, supported by a relevant degree or equivalent experience. Familiarity with tools like Git, Docker, cloud services (e.g., AWS or Azure), and knowledge of REST APIs or GraphQL is typically required, with certifications in web development or cloud platforms being a plus. Excellent communication, proactive problem-solving, and self-motivation are vital soft skills for succeeding in a distributed team environment. These competencies enable you to effectively build, deploy, and maintain robust web applications while collaborating efficiently with cross-functional teams remotely.

What does a typical day look like for a Remote Full Stack Web Developer?

A typical day as a Remote Full Stack Web Developer involves participating in virtual stand-up meetings, collaborating with team members via chat or video calls, and writing and reviewing code for both the front-end and back-end of web applications. You may also work on debugging issues, implementing new features, and managing deployments to production environments. Clear communication and effective time management are crucial, since you'll be coordinating tasks and updates with colleagues across different time zones. Most remote teams use project management tools like Jira or Trello and version control platforms like GitHub to stay organized, ensuring seamless collaboration and project progress.

What is a Remote Full Stack Web Developer job?

A Remote Full Stack Web Developer is a professional who builds and maintains both the front-end and back-end of websites or web applications while working from a remote location. They handle databases, servers, and client-side interfaces, using various programming languages and frameworks. This role requires strong problem-solving skills, collaboration with teams via online tools, and the ability to work independently. Remote developers often communicate through video calls, emails, and project management software to stay aligned with team goals.
